NetEase Cloud Music Restarts IPO and Uploads New Data Set

On Tuesday, the Hong Kong Stock Exchange’s website showed that NetEase Cloud Music has uploaded a brand-new post-hearing data set, and its co-sponsors for the listing are BoFA Securities, CICC and Credit Suisse AG.

Previously, this past August, NetEase Cloud Music passed the listing hearing of HKEx. Later, however, the company decided to postpone its listing. At that time, the company commented on the move, “Managing executives decide to postpone the listing after considering comprehensive factors including overall market environment.”

The latest data suggests that, in the first three quarters of 2021, the total revenue of NetEase Cloud Music was 5.1 billion yuan ($799 million), a year-on-year increase of 52%. Over the same period, its net loss narrowed significantly, and gross profit margin increased remarkably to a positive 0.4%. In the first half this year, adjusted net losses decreased to 500 million yuan from 800 million yuan in the same period as last year.

Specifically, in the first three quarters of this year, revenue of the online music sector totalled more than 2.24 billion yuan, up from 1.85 billion yuan in the same period of 2020. Meanwhile, monthly active users (MAU) of the online music sector increased to 184 million from 180 million in the same period last year. The number of paid online music users amounted to 27.52 million, a year-on-year increase of over 93% and online music payment rate reached 14.9%.

The company maintained stable growth in its social entertainment services and other sectors. The company credits the strong development of its live-streaming business. In the first three quarters, the social entertainment service MAU was 21.1 million while the number of paid users reached 580,000, a year-on-year increase of 93%. The average monthly revenue per paying user (ARPPU) of social entertainment services is 504.1 yuan.

Community user-generated content (UGC) and listening length continues to grow as the platform is favored by the younger generation. As a leading music community in the world, in the first half of 2021, daily active users spent 76.9 minutes on the platform, and the number of UGC songs totaled 2.8 billion.

In June 2021, about 27% of MAU created their own content and posted it on the platform, while 3 out of every 10 songs were recommended by the platform. The data set suggests that over 90% of the MAU were born post-90s or post-00s. NetEase Cloud Music is indeed one of the most popular music platforms in China overall.

Recently, NetEase Cloud Music has reached copyright cooperation agreements with Modern Sky, Emperor Entertainment Group (Hong Kong) and the China Record Corporation. The platform now offers songs created by many famous artists, bands and musicians, such as Nicholas Tse, Joey Yung, Twins, New Pants, Miserable Faith and Wutiaoren. According to analysis by Western Securities, under the premise of gradually eliminating copyright monopoly in the music industry, the core competition of online music platform relies on ecological construction and user operation experience, aspects  NetEase Cloud Music sees itself as having several advantages.

NetEase Cloud Music’s post-hearing data set also suggests that the new funds will be mainly used for strengthening the music community. This fundraising will also support a greater diversity of music content, innovation and technical capabilities, and is for merger, acquisition and strategic investment purposes.
